Aniello Ambrosio, a 71-year-old pensioner who disappeared on February 20, was found lifeless this afternoon in a well in St. Joseph Vesuvius, in the province of Naples.
The body was recovered by firefighters and is now in the custody of the magistrate on duty at the Nola Public Prosecutor's Office for an autopsy.
The search for Aniello Ambrosio had ended three days after his disappearance, but today, unfortunately, a disturbing discovery was made.
The clothes worn by the pensioner allowed his family to recognize him on the spot. The agents of the San Giuseppe Vesuviano police station are investigating the matter to understand how he ended up in that well.
